“The Century Handbook of Writing” by Garland Greever and Easley S. Jones is a quintessential guide for mastering the art of writing, first published in 1918 by The Century Co. in New York. This reprinted edition from September 1918 serves as a comprehensive reference for students and educators alike. The book is structured around a decimal plan, simplifying complex rules of grammar, diction, and rhetoric into digestible sections. It includes a range of exercises designed to reinforce learning and ensure practical application.
